This course is designed for middle schoolers. Students will learn grammar, poetry, literature, writing, and vocabulary to build upon the skills from English I and is designed to flow into the next course (English III). Grades 5th to 8th

Prerequisites
Prerequisite is English I OR (1) the ability to recognize almost all parts of speech, (2) the ability to read at grade level, (3) the ability to write a series of related sentences to form a simple paragraph.
Materials
Visit www.royalfireworkspress.com to view Michael Clay Thompson’s Grammar Town, Caesar’s English I, Building Poems, Practice Town, and Paragraph Town (video about MCT’s books). Novels include Tuck Everlasting, The Giver, Number the Stars, The Swiss Family Robinson, Roll of Thunder, Hear My Cry, and various short stories provided by the instructor.
